1. Understand the Exam Structure and Content:

  • Official Exam Guide: The official exam guide will provide detailed information about the exam format, sections, topics covered, and scoring.
  • Syllabus: Your syllabus will outline the specific topics and learning objectives that will be assessed.
  • Past Exam Papers (if available): If past exam papers are available, analyze them to understand the types of questions asked and the difficulty level.

2. Develop a Study Plan:

  • Set Realistic Goals: Break down the syllabus into manageable chunks and allocate sufficient time for each topic.
  • Prioritize Topics: Identify your strengths and weaknesses and focus on areas that require more attention.
  • Use a Variety of Study Materials: Utilize textbooks, study guides, online resources, and practice questions.

3. Active Learning Techniques:

  • Active Reading: Engage with the material by highlighting key points, taking notes, and summarizing concepts.
  • Practice Questions: Solve as many practice questions as possible to familiarize yourself with the exam format and improve your problem-solving skills.
  • Mock Exams: Take mock exams under timed conditions to simulate the real exam environment and identify areas for improvement.

4. Seek Guidance and Support:

  • Professors and Instructors: Reach out to your professors or instructors for clarification on challenging concepts.
  • Study Groups: Collaborate with classmates to discuss topics, share insights, and motivate each other.
  • Online Forums and Communities: Join online forums or communities related to your field to connect with other students and professionals.
